The APEX 81646 is a double-end flare nut wrench sized 13MM x 14MM, built for loosening and tightening hex nuts on tubing connections such as fuel lines and brake lines. Manufactured from alloy steel with a full polish chrome finish, this standard-pattern wrench provides the enclosed-end geometry needed to grip hex nuts without slipping off tubing. At 7.035 inches in length and 0.29 pounds, it is compact enough for tight underhood spaces while still delivering adequate leverage for stubborn fittings. A single wrench covers two common metric sizes, reducing the number of tools needed on the job.
This wrench is suited for use on hex fittings wherever tubing passes through the nut, a common configuration in automotive fuel and brake systems, HVAC refrigerant line sets, and plumbing compression fittings. The flare nut opening allows the wrench to pass over the tube and seat fully on the hex before applying torque, minimizing the risk of rounding soft fittings. Technicians working on metric-dimensioned systems will find the 13MM and 14MM sizes cover frequently encountered fitting sizes in a single tool.

Relieve system pressure and shut off fluid supply before loosening any line fitting. Seat the wrench fully on the hex before applying torque to avoid rounding the fitting. Automotive technicians and plumbers working on compression or flare fittings should follow applicable safety procedures for the fluid system being serviced.
